From the recording IS THERE ANYBODY OUT THERE?
Indian Raga meets Klezmer, meets whimsical Americana? Baying lone wolf meets sighing solo voice sitting on the Moon? Yup, from first note to last, all in the same cinematic song. Top Ten Southern Gospel & Positive Country artists Amy & Adams’ new single IS THERE ANYBODY OUT THERE? from their forthcoming 9th album RIDING ON THE WIND is a luscious romp through all of the above with as fine an acoustic ensemble as anyone out there!
